excel 怎么记录身份证号

excel 怎么记录身份证号

一、在Excel中记录身份证号的方法有以下几种:格式设置、文本格式、输入单引号、数据验证。其中,最常用的方法是将单元格格式设置为文本格式。这样做可以确保身份证号前的零不会被自动去掉,并且输入的身份证号不会被科学计数法格式化。接下来,我们详细讲解其中的文本格式方法。

在Excel中,将单元格格式设置为文本格式非常简单,只需选中需要输入身份证号的单元格或列,然后右键选择“设置单元格格式”,在弹出的对话框中选择“文本”格式即可。这样,输入的身份证号将以文本形式存储,保证其准确性。

二、设置单元格格式为文本

1、设置单元格格式为文本

为了确保身份证号能正确记录并显示,首先要设置单元格格式为文本。这样可以避免Excel将身份证号自动转化为科学计数法形式或去掉身份证号前的零。

步骤如下:

  1. 选中需要输入身份证号的单元格或列。
  2. 右键单击,选择“设置单元格格式”。
  3. 在弹出的对话框中,选择“文本”选项。
  4. 点击“确定”按钮。

这样就可以确保输入的身份证号以文本形式存储,避免格式错误。

2、使用数据验证来保证输入格式

在Excel中,我们还可以使用数据验证功能来确保输入的身份证号格式正确。数据验证可以帮助我们限制输入的类型和格式,确保数据的准确性。

步骤如下:

  1. 选中需要输入身份证号的单元格或列。
  2. 点击菜单栏中的“数据”选项,然后选择“数据验证”。
  3. 在弹出的对话框中,选择“自定义”。
  4. 在公式框中输入一个自定义公式,如 =AND(ISNUMBER(A1), LEN(A1)=18),确保输入的是数字且长度为18位。
  5. 点击“确定”按钮。

通过设置数据验证,可以确保输入的身份证号符合预期格式,减少输入错误。

三、使用单引号输入身份证号

3、使用单引号输入身份证号

在Excel中,使用单引号(')作为前缀输入身份证号也是一种常见的方法。这样做的好处是,可以强制Excel将输入的内容识别为文本。

步骤如下:

  1. 在需要输入身份证号的单元格中,输入单引号(')。
  2. 在单引号后面输入身份证号,如 '123456789012345678
  3. 按回车键确认。

这样,Excel会将输入的身份证号识别为文本,并且不会自动去掉前面的零或将其转化为科学计数法。

4、使用公式处理身份证号

在Excel中,我们还可以使用公式来处理身份证号,以确保其格式正确。例如,可以使用 TEXT 函数将数字转化为文本格式,或使用 CONCATENATE 函数将不同单元格中的内容拼接成完整的身份证号。

示例公式:

  1. 使用 TEXT 函数将数字转化为文本格式:

    =TEXT(A1, "0")

    这样可以确保A1单元格中的内容以文本形式显示。

  2. 使用 CONCATENATE 函数拼接身份证号:

    =CONCATENATE(A1, A2, A3)

    这样可以将A1、A2、A3单元格中的内容拼接成一个完整的身份证号。

四、使用VBA自动化处理身份证号

5、使用VBA自动化处理身份证号

对于大量数据处理,Excel的VBA(Visual Basic for Applications)是一种强大工具。可以编写VBA代码自动化处理身份证号的输入和格式化。

示例代码:

  1. 打开Excel,按Alt + F11键进入VBA编辑器。
  2. 在“插入”菜单中选择“模块”。
  3. 在模块中输入以下代码:
    Sub FormatIDCard()

    Dim rng As Range

    For Each rng In Selection

    If Len(rng.Value) = 18 And IsNumeric(rng.Value) Then

    rng.NumberFormat = "@"

    End If

    Next rng

    End Sub

  4. 关闭VBA编辑器,返回Excel。
  5. 选中需要格式化的单元格或列,按Alt + F8键,选择并运行“FormatIDCard”宏。

这样,选中的单元格中的身份证号将自动设置为文本格式,确保其正确显示。

五、处理身份证号常见问题

6、处理身份证号常见问题

在实际操作中,我们可能会遇到一些常见问题,如身份证号前导零被去掉、身份证号显示为科学计数法等。下面我们来探讨如何处理这些问题。

问题1:身份证号前导零被去掉

解决方法:将单元格格式设置为文本,或使用单引号输入身份证号。

问题2:身份证号显示为科学计数法

解决方法:将单元格格式设置为文本,或使用 TEXT 函数将数字转化为文本格式。

问题3:身份证号输入错误

解决方法:使用数据验证功能限制输入格式,确保输入的身份证号长度为18位且为数字。

7、数据处理和分析

除了记录身份证号,Excel还可以帮助我们进行数据处理和分析。例如,可以使用Excel的筛选和排序功能,快速查找和整理身份证号数据。

示例操作:

  1. 选中包含身份证号的列,点击菜单栏中的“数据”选项。
  2. 使用“排序和筛选”功能,按升序或降序排序身份证号。
  3. 使用“筛选”功能,查找特定条件下的身份证号,如特定年份或地区的身份证号。

通过这些功能,可以更高效地管理和分析身份证号数据。

六、保护身份证号数据

8、保护身份证号数据

在处理身份证号数据时,数据的安全和隐私保护非常重要。以下是一些保护身份证号数据的建议:

建议1:使用密码保护工作簿

为Excel工作簿设置密码,防止未经授权的访问。

建议2:隐藏或加密身份证号列

对于敏感数据,可以使用Excel的隐藏功能,或使用加密工具对身份证号列进行加密。

9、备份和恢复数据

定期备份身份证号数据,防止数据丢失。可以将数据备份到云存储或外部存储设备中。

备份步骤:

  1. 将Excel工作簿保存到云存储(如OneDrive、Google Drive)或外部存储设备。
  2. 定期更新备份,确保数据的最新状态。

通过以上方法,可以有效地记录、管理和保护身份证号数据,确保数据的准确性和安全性。

七、身份证号数据应用实例

10、身份证号数据应用实例

在实际工作中,身份证号数据的应用范围非常广泛。以下是几个常见的应用实例:

实例1:员工信息管理

在企业中,身份证号是员工信息管理的重要组成部分。通过Excel记录员工的身份证号,可以方便地进行身份验证、工资发放等工作。

实例2:客户信息管理

在客户管理系统中,身份证号是客户身份验证的重要依据。通过Excel记录客户的身份证号,可以方便地进行客户信息管理和服务。

11、实例3:会员信息管理

在会员管理系统中,身份证号是会员身份验证的重要依据。通过Excel记录会员的身份证号,可以方便地进行会员信息管理和服务。

实例4:学生信息管理

在教育机构中,身份证号是学生信息管理的重要组成部分。通过Excel记录学生的身份证号,可以方便地进行学生身份验证、成绩管理等工作。

12、实例5:医院患者信息管理

在医疗机构中,身份证号是患者信息管理的重要组成部分。通过Excel记录患者的身份证号,可以方便地进行患者身份验证、病历管理等工作。

通过以上实例,可以看到身份证号数据在不同领域中的广泛应用。合理使用Excel记录和管理身份证号数据,可以提高工作效率,确保数据的准确性和安全性。

八、总结与建议

13、总结与建议

通过本文的介绍,我们详细讲解了在Excel中记录身份证号的多种方法,包括设置单元格格式为文本、使用数据验证、使用单引号输入、使用公式处理、使用VBA自动化处理等。同时,我们还探讨了如何处理身份证号常见问题、保护身份证号数据、以及身份证号数据的实际应用实例。

在实际操作中,选择合适的方法记录和管理身份证号数据,可以有效提高工作效率,确保数据的准确性和安全性。希望本文的内容对您在Excel中记录身份证号有所帮助。

建议1:根据实际需求选择合适的方法

不同的方法有不同的适用场景,根据实际需求选择合适的方法记录身份证号数据。

建议2:定期备份数据

定期备份身份证号数据,确保数据的安全性,防止数据丢失。

建议3:加强数据保护

采取必要的措施保护身份证号数据,防止未经授权的访问和泄露。

通过合理使用Excel的功能和工具,可以更高效地记录和管理身份证号数据,确保数据的准确性和安全性。

相关问答FAQs:

1. 身份证号在Excel中如何记录?
在Excel中,身份证号可以直接在单元格中输入,或者使用特定的格式进行记录。你可以将身份证号作为文本格式进行输入,以避免Excel自动将其转换为数字或日期格式。或者,你可以使用自定义格式将身份证号显示为特定的格式,例如:xxxxxx-xxxxxxx-xx-x。

2. 如何在Excel中快速生成身份证号?
如果你需要在Excel中生成多个身份证号,可以使用Excel的函数和公式来实现。你可以使用随机数函数(如RAND())结合其他函数,如左右函数(LEFT()和RIGHT())和文本函数(如TEXT()),来生成符合身份证号格式的随机数。

3. 我如何在Excel中验证身份证号的有效性?
要验证身份证号的有效性,你可以使用Excel的数据验证功能。首先,选择要进行验证的单元格范围,然后打开“数据”选项卡,选择“数据工具”组中的“数据验证”。在弹出的对话框中,选择“整数”或“文本长度”选项,并设置相应的条件和限制,以确保输入的值符合身份证号的格式和长度要求。这样,当你输入一个无效的身份证号时,Excel会自动给出警告提示。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4847726

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部